What road cycling is

Road cycling events cover a wide range of formats — from non-competitive gran fondos and century rides to closed-course criteriums, time trials, and road races. What they share is sustained effort over a long distance on a bike, usually on paved roads.

Many events offer several distance options at the same venue, so you can pick the route that matches you. Beginner-friendly gran fondos make a welcoming entry point.
